1. Understanding Cambridge’s Admissions Philosophy | 理解剑桥大学的录取理念

Cambridge admissions tutors seek evidence of scholarly potential rather than mere exam proficiency. They value candidates who are deeply immersed in their chosen field, able to handle abstract concepts, and comfortable with self-directed study. Your A-Level subjects become the primary tool for demonstrating this intellectual readiness.

2. The Importance of Subject Rigour and Relevance | 学科严谨性与相关性的重要性

Not all A-Level subjects are perceived as equally rigorous. Cambridge traditionally distinguishes between ‘facilitating’ subjects and those considered less academically demanding. Although the formal facilitating subjects list has been retired, the underlying preferences remain deeply embedded in admissions culture, especially for arts and science courses alike.

Subjects like Mathematics, Further Mathematics, Physics, Chemistry, Biology, History, English Literature, Geography, and Modern Languages are consistently favoured because they demand high-level analytical skills, sustained argument, and independent thinking. Conversely, subjects with a strong vocational flavour – such as Business Studies, Media Studies, or Travel and Tourism – are rarely viewed as adequate preparation for Cambridge’s academic intensity.

Relevance to the chosen course is paramount. An applicant for Engineering must demonstrate mathematical fluency and physics knowledge; an English applicant should show literary analysis across genres. Selecting subjects that correspond directly to your intended degree signals commitment and builds a cohesive narrative for your personal statement.

3. Core Facilitating Subjects for Cambridge Applicants | 剑桥申请者的核心促进学科

Mathematics and Further Mathematics form the backbone of any quantitative application. For courses like Mathematics, Economics, Engineering, Computer Science, and Natural Sciences, taking Further Mathematics to AS or full A-Level is almost a de facto requirement, as it develops the mathematical maturity essential for university-level study.

In the sciences, Chemistry is indispensable for Medicine, Biochemistry, and Natural Sciences (Biological). Physics provides the foundation for Engineering, Materials Science, and Physical Natural Sciences. Biology applicants for life sciences frequently combine it with Chemistry and another science or Mathematics.

For humanities and social sciences, History offers source analysis and essay skills; English Literature builds critical interpretation; and a modern language demonstrates linguistic agility and cultural awareness. Economics is highly valued but should be paired with Mathematics to avoid appearing one-dimensional.

4. Subject-Specific Requirements by Course | 按专业划分的科目要求

Cambridge courses often have very explicit A-Level prerequisites that must be satisfied before an application will be considered. For instance, Medicine (Standard Course) typically requires A-Levels in Chemistry and one of Biology, Physics, or Mathematics; many successful applicants hold three sciences or two sciences and Mathematics.

For Engineering, Mathematics and Physics are required, with Further Mathematics strongly recommended. Computer Science demands Mathematics, and Further Mathematics is extremely beneficial given the theoretical nature of the Cambridge course, which relies heavily on discrete mathematics and logic.

Humanities courses like History may not have mandatory A-Level subjects, but History itself is obviously recommended. Archaeology accepts a mix of sciences and humanities, while Law expects applicants to have a strong essay-based subject. Checking the specific entry requirements on the Cambridge website for your desired course is non-negotiable.

5. Avoiding Non-Preferred and Overlapping Subjects | 避开非首选和重叠科目

Cambridge explicitly states that Certain subjects are not considered suitable preparation: General Studies, Critical Thinking, and Thinking Skills are generally excluded from conditional offers. While they might develop transferable skills, they do not provide the subject-specific depth Cambridge expects.

Overlapping subjects can also diminish an application’s strength. For example, taking both Economics and Business Studies, or both Sociology and Psychology, may suggest a lack of academic breadth or a reluctance to engage with more challenging disciplines. Admissions tutors prefer combinations that demonstrate complementary rigour rather than content duplication.

6. The Rise of Multi-Exam Board Strategies | 多考试局组合策略的兴起

Traditionally, students would take all their A-Levels with a single UK exam board through one school or college. However, the growing availability of international exam centres and the modular flexibility of some boards has enabled candidates to mix qualifications from different awarding bodies – a trend increasingly recognised by top universities, provided the overall academic profile remains coherent.

7. Choosing Exam Boards for Modular vs Linear Assessment | 根据模块化与线性评估选择考试局

Cambridge International (CIE) A-Levels are predominantly linear, with exams taken at the end of the two-year course, though some subjects offer staged assessment routes. This suits learners who prefer to build knowledge cumulatively and be tested on the full syllabus at once, mirroring the terminal exam style common at Cambridge colleges.

8. Optimising Grades through Resit and Practical Components | 通过重考和实践部分优化成绩

Resit policies vary markedly between exam boards, and this can become a decisive factor. Cambridge International generally allows resits for individual units in staged assessment subjects but encourages linear resits; Edexcel International A-Levels allow unit resits which count towards the final cash-in, making it easier to improve a borderline grade.

For science subjects, the practical endorsement (Pass/Fail) is separate from the A-Level grade. In CIE, practical skills are assessed in the written papers or as a separate component, while UK A-Levels have a non-exam practical endorsement. An applicant can potentially take a CIE science A-Level to have practical skills contribute to the grade, or use a UK board to obtain a separate practical certificate, demonstrating hands-on competence without the pressure of graded practical exams.

11. Case Study: A Balanced Combination for a Science Applicant | 案例研究:理科申请者的平衡组合

Consider a student targeting Cambridge Engineering. They opt for Edexcel International A-Level Mathematics (four units, modular) to ensure they can resit Mechanics 1 if needed, while simultaneously taking CIE Further Mathematics (linear) to demonstrate readiness for Cambridge’s mathematical rigour. For Physics, they choose OCR A-Level (linear) because its ‘Practical Endorsement’ frees them from graded practical exams without neglecting lab skills.

12. Final Recommendations for Aspiring Cambridge Students | 给志向剑桥学生的最终建议

Start by rigorously researching your intended Cambridge course and its sub-disciplines. Use the university’s subject pages to identify essential and recommended A-Levels, then reverse-engineer your portfolio. Never select a subject solely because it is perceived as easy or because a particular board offers a higher A* rate; alignment with Cambridge’s ethos of deep learning matters more.

Finally, avoid over-complicating. A clean, rigorous combination of three strongly facilitating A-Levels from a single reputable board remains a classic and widely accepted route. The multi-board approach is a refinement for specific circumstances, not a universal mandate. Prioritise genuine interest and academic engagement above tactical optimisation, as these are the qualities that shine through at Cambridge’s rigorous interviews and admissions assessments.
